Age Group Formats

Match formats, durations, ball sizes and substitutions for every age group at The Newcastle International Summer Cup 2026.

Match Formats & Durations

Age GroupFormatSubstitutionsBall Size Group StageKnockouts
U107-a-sideUnlimitedSize 31 × 30 min2 × 20 min
U117-a-sideUnlimitedSize 31 × 30 min2 × 20 min
U129-a-sideUnlimitedSize 41 × 25 min2 × 15 min
U12 Girls9-a-sideUnlimitedSize 41 × 30 min2 × 20 min
U139-a-sideUnlimitedSize 41 × 25 min2 × 15 min
U1411-a-side5 per matchSize 51 × 25 min2 × 15 min
U1511-a-side5 per matchSize 51 × 30 min2 × 20 min

Key Format Notes

  • Teams in the 7-a-side & 9-a-side categories may make unlimited substitutions (roll on, roll off) — players need the referee's permission to leave and join the game.
  • Teams in the 11-a-side categories may make five substitutions in total per match, from a maximum match squad of 18.
  • Every age category is split into two groups. The top two teams progress to the Cup competition; all others go into the Plate or Bowl depending on group placing.
  • Offsides are in play for U12–U15 age groups, at the referee's discretion.
  • Deliberate heading is not permitted at U10 & U11, in line with FA guidelines introduced from the 2026/27 season.
  • All age groups play on 3G astroturf, with the exception of U12 Girls, who play on grass.
  • All football-specific rules are in line with FA standards.
